The Department of Computer Science and the Department of Sociology and
Anthropology at Trinity University, San Antonio, TX, are pleased to
offer a 10-week REU (Research Experiences for Undergraduates) program
where students will work collaboratively on a wide variety of AI &
multi-agent systems problems. We will use multi-agent systems to
simulate social environments. This experience will benefit students who
are interested in real-world problems.
Deadline for application: March 31, 2008.
Eligibility: Funding is limited to United States citizens or US
permanent residents. Women and minorities are particularly encouraged to
apply.
Funding: Each participant will receive
- a stipend of $4,000
- free housing in university dormitories
- travel expenses to and from San Antonio
- an afternoon refreshment break everyday and a social dinner each week.
